About Apotex Inc.
Apotex is a Canadian-based global health company. We improve everyday access to affordable, innovative medicines and health products for millions of people worldwide, with a broad portfolio of generic, biosimilar, innovative branded pharmaceuticals and consumer health products. Headquartered in Toronto, with regional offices globally, including in the United States, Mexico and India, we are the largest Canadian-based pharmaceutical company and a health partner of choice for the Americas for pharmaceutical licensing and product acquisitions.

Job Summary
The Director, Total Rewards will be responsible for leading Apotex’s global compensation and benefit programs, processes and delivery for all levels and countries including compensation philosophy and principles, base salary structures and job architecture, annual short term/long term incentive programs, sales incentive plans and our global benefits and pension (savings) plans. This is critical role on the Total Rewards team that will work closely with Talent Management, Human Resources Business Partner (HRBP) and Human Resources Shared Services (HRSS) teams to ensure Apotex can attract, motivate and retain talent.
The successful candidate in this role will lead innovative initiatives that promote best in class global compensation and benefits delivery, ensure market competitiveness, cost effectiveness and easy to administer programs for executives, management and employees and the company.
